Where: Moon Cafe ( Level 2, Ayala Terraces Cebu City) I so love Moon Cafe! They serve Mexican food with a Filipino twist. Their food is affordable, big servings and the ambiance is great.
Sinulog Cebu
Annually we have Sinulog Festival here in Cebu City, Philippines and to me this is the most exciting event of all events! People from all parts of Philippines and people from other parts of the globe come down here to celebrate. This is the season when love and alcohol is free flowing 😀
